The Emerging Demand For Desktop Publishing Courses

Desktop publishing (or DTP) software is a page layout software that has the ability to create documents for publication purposes for small scale or large scale publishing houses. A page layout structure is formed by this software in the form of texts, pictures, animations and many more types of visual effects. Some examples of software that create visual effects in desktop publishing software are QuarkXPress, InDesign, Free Scribus and Microsoft desktop publisher graphic software. The skills used to create the layout of a page along with the same software can be used to create graphic presentations for sales projects, item promotions, and exhibitions for trade shows, signs and packaging signs. As desktop publishing finds its application in a number of fields, there are a number of job opportunities in this sector. And due to the increasing demand of those who know its application, there are a number of desktop publishing courses in the market.

These courses enable us to learn what all the package is all about and how can we find its application for various purposes. Such courses are available in the form of traditional classes, online or through email classes.
